8.1 Inspection and maintenance intervals
NOTES ON EXPLOSION PROTECTION
Use only original spare parts from the relevant and valid spare parts lists; other-
wise, the approval for hazardous locations of the motor will become void.
The routine test must be repeated whenever motor parts relating to explosion pro-
tection are replaced.
Make sure that the motor is assembled correctly and all openings have been
sealed after service and maintenance work.
Clean motors for hazardous locations regularly. Prevent dust from building up
higher than 5 mm.
Explosion protection is largely dependent on the IP enclosure. Therefore, always
check that the seals are fitted correctly and in perfect condition when performing
any work on the machine.
Explosion protection can only be ensured if motors are serviced and maintained
properly.
If you repaint motors or gearmotors, observe the requirements for preventing elec-
trostatic charging according to EN / IEC 60079-0, see chapter "Painting" in the cor-
responding detailed operating instructions.
Unit / part of unit Time interval What to do?
Motor Every 10,000 operating hours Motor inspection:
Check rolling bearing and
change if necessary
Replace oil seal
Clean the cooling air passages
Motor with backstop Change the low-viscosity grease
of the backstop
Drive •Varies
(depending on external factors)
Touch up or renew the sur-
faces/anticorrosion coating
Air ducts and surfaces of
the motor and the forced
cooling fan if applicable
•Varies
(depending on external factors)
Clean the air ducts and surfaces
